The total volume of gas tolerated in humans is<br />

hard to estimate<br />

Small volumes can lead to symptoms, particularly<br />

if paradoxical air embolism ensues, potentially<br />

causing cardiovascular and/or neurological<br />

problems<br />

Volumes between 100-300 ml can be fatal<br />

(approximately 1 mg.kg -1 )<br />

This volume is relevant, since it has been shown<br />

that 100 ml of air per second can be entrained<br />

through a 14 gauge cannula with only 5 cm<br />

pressure gradient
